About The Position

Under minimal supervision, provides Service Order and/or Project evaluation and estimates to include: construction, modification, and/or maintenance repairs of facilities and facility systems. Employees in this job class manage a wide range of service orders and projects involving the integration of structural, electrical, heating ventilation and cooling, engineering, and mechanical activities. They also are responsible for managing the Period of Performance and Scope of Work. This job requires extensive knowledge of construction project management, building codes, applicable state and federal laws relating to construction and the ability to effectively manage Subcontractors to meet time and cost requirements.

Responsibilities

  • Provides hands-on project management and actively manages project plans, deliverables, and outcomes for approved projects. Tracks progress and ensures project goals and objectives are achieved within established time frames, adherence to guidelines, and within planned budgets.
  • Obtains necessary approvals from customer when projects are completed and closes out projects.
  • Provides technical direction and project management support to PRIDE employees involved in construction activities such as in defining project scope, requirements, and staffing.
  • Oversees subcontractors, and coordinates with vendors on deliveries, and quality of products and/or services provided.
  • Defines and manages overall project risk identification and mitigation processes through interaction with subcontractors, customers, and site management.
  • Meets with customer to discuss proposed projects and potential revisions. Reviews project progress and discusses deviations from proposed schedules or methodologies, and any PRIDE performance against customer expectations issues.
  • Ensures that work performed is compliant with regulatory, safety, and licensing standards and requirements.
  • Ensures project documentation is sufficiently detailed to answer questions from customer or other government personnel.
